About the session

M.A.2.1

Ultra-Compact Silicon IQ Modulator Beyond 100 GBaud

Alireza Geravand, Zibo Zheng, Simon Levasseur, leslie rusch, wei shi

Laval university, Quebec, Canada

M.A.2.2

Silicon Photonic Direct-Detection Phase Retrieval Receiver

Brian Stern, Haoshuo Chen, Kwangwoong Kim, Hanzi Huang, Jie Zhao, Mohamad Idjadi

Nokia Bell Labs, Murray Hill, USA

M.A.2.3

Mid-IR Soliton Microcomb Generation in Silicon Nitride Microring Resonators

Anamika Nair Karunakaran1, Marco Clementi2, Ozan Yakar2, Christian Lafforgue2, Anton Stroganov3, Poul Varming1, Minhao Pu4, Patrick Montague1, Kresten Yvind4, Camille-Sophie Bres2

1 NKT Photonics, Copenhagen, Denmark. 2 EPFL, Lausanne, Switzerland. 3 LIGENTEC, Lausanne, Switzerland. 4 Technical University of Denmark, Copenhagen, Denmark

M.A.2.4

High Bandwidth All Silicon MOS-Capacitor Ring Modulators

weiwei zhang1, MARTIN EBERT2, KE LI1, BIGENG CHEN1, XINGZHAO YAN1, HAN DU1, MEHDI BANAKAR1, YING TRAN1, CALLUM LITTLEJOHNS1, ADAM SCOFIELD3, GUOMIN YU3, ROSHANAK SHAFIIHA3, AARON ZILKIE1, GRAHAM REED1, DAVID THOMSON1

1 Optoelectronics Research Centre, University of Southampton, southampton, United Kingdom. 2 Optoelectronics Research Centre, University of Southampton, Southampton, United Kingdom. 3 Rockley Photonics, Pasadena, USA

M.A.2.5

Demonstration of a Silicon Ring Resonator Coupling-Modulator-based Coherent Optical Sub-Assembly Operating at 802 Gbps

Xi Chen1, Ajay Mistry2, Meisam Bahadori2, Kishore Padmaraju2, Marcin Malinowski2, Di Che1, Rafid Sukkar2, Rick Younce2, Alexandre Horth2, Yury Dziashko2, Hang Guan2, Ruizhi Shi2, Douglas Gill2, Asres Seyoum2, Jeewan Naik2, Daihyun Lim2, Ahmed El Sayed2, Alexander Rylyakov2, Mike Schmidt2, Zhouchen Luo2, Peter Magill2, Gary Burrell2, Juthika Basak2, David Chapman2, Anna Mikami2, Andreas Leven2

1 Nokia Bell Labs, New Providence, USA. 2 Nokia, New York, USA

M.A.2.6

Towards 3.2 Tb/s Direct Detection Polarization-Multiplexed Transceivers using on-chip Microring assisted Coherent Network

David Weng U Chan1, Dan Yi1, Yeyu Tong2, Chi-Wai Chow3, Hon Ki Tsang1

1 The Chinese University of Hong Kong, Shatin, Hong Kong. 2 The Hong Kong University of Science and Technology (Guangzhou), Guangzhou, China. 3 National Yang Ming Chiao Tung University, Hsinchu, Taiwan
